A real-world example comes from a 40W general-purpose AC input, critical conduction mode, interleaved PFC boost converter. This circuit diagram uses the R2A20112 as the controller, showing the master and slave channels, input/output capacitors, and boost inductors. For those looking to build or repair a PFC circuit, the critical components to check are the main switching MOSFETs, boost diodes, and all components connected to the ZCD pins, as their failure is a common cause of a non-working PFC stage.
